Abstract

Applying the techniques of resonant and off-resonant Doppler-free 2-photon laser spectroscopy, we have studied a number of transitions in the group IIIa elements Al, Ga and Tl with the thermionic diode. In order to check the accuracy of the experimental set-up and the spectroscopic method applied, the hfs of the intermediate state 3d 2D3/2,5/2 of 27Al has been determined from the spectra of the 3p 2PJ-3d 2DJ-nf 2FJ or -np 2PJ transitions and compared with more precise values by other authors from atomic beam magnetic resonance measurements. From 4p 2P1/2-nf 2FJ and 4p 2PJ-4d 2DJ-nf 2FJ or -np 2PJ transitions in 69,71Ga, we have deduced the hfs and the residual isotope shifts (RLIS) of the intermediate states (4d 2D3/2,5/2) and the RLIS of the 4p 2P1/2,3/2 ground states. In Tl, we have measured the 6p 2P1/2-nf2F5/2 (n = 6-9) and -10p 2P3/2 lines. From the experimental results we have determined the residual level isotope shift (205,203Tl) of the 6p 2P1/2 state and the hfs of the 10p 2P3/2 level.
